Right I've had enough of this, its confusing the hell out of me!

Nothing's loose behind the fusebox, I've got power at the grey/green wire at back of the switch, power at the 2 grey/green wires on the blue multiplug and the black multiplug, also got power at the grey/green wire on the left hand side in the far corner of the boot where the wire joins the loom for the number plate lights. But no power across where fuse number 20 goes in the fusebox! Also I must say that although its showing power at the plug in the boot, theres no power at the plugs for the number plate lights. I can't get my head around this. I'm guessing as I have no power across the fuse but power at the back of it with good connections, that my fusebox maybe at fault? I have another one so would that be a good plan?

if theres power in the boot then there is power at the fuse, unless some serious bodging has gone on. check in the rubber boot on driver side between tailgate and body for damage, and check the brown wires on plate light plugs for continuity to ground
